# frozen_string_literal: true module DataHelper require "faker" class << self # Generate a human-readable username with a random number inserted def generate_human_username base_username = Faker::Internet.username(specifier: 8..12) random_number = rand(100..999) random_position = rand(0..base_username.length) base_username.insert(random_position, random_number.to_s) end # Generate a random phone number (can specify format: :national, :international, :mobile) def generate_phone_number(format: :national) case format when :national Faker::PhoneNumber.phone_number when :international Faker::PhoneNumber.cell_phone_in_e164 when :mobile Faker::PhoneNumber.cell_phone else Faker::PhoneNumber.phone_number end end # Generate a random email address (can specify domain) def generate_email(username = nil, domain = "example.com") username ||= Faker::Internet.username(specifier: 8..12) "#{username}@#{domain}" end # Generate a secure random password def generate_secure_password(length: 12) Faker::Internet.password(min_length: length, mix_case: true, special_characters: true) end # Generate a random full name (first and last) def generate_full_name "#{Faker::Name.first_name} #{Faker::Name.last_name}" end # Generate a random address def generate_address "#{Faker::Address.street_address}, #{Faker::Address.city}, #{Faker::Address.zip}" end # Generate a random date of birth (for users between min_age and max_age) def generate_date_of_birth(min_age: 18, max_age: 65) Faker::Date.birthday(min_age: min_age, max_age: max_age) end # Generate a random company name def generate_company_name Faker::Company.name end # Generate a random IPv4 or IPv6 address def generate_ip_address(version: :v4) case version when :v4 Faker::Internet.ip_v4_address when :v6 Faker::Internet.ip_v6_address else Faker::Internet.ip_v4_address end end end end
